Zephyr API Documentation 4.1.99
A Scalable Open Source RTOS
 4.1.99
All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Modules Pages
if.h File Reference

Go to the source code of this file.

Data Structures

struct  if_nameindex
 

Macros

#define IF_NAMESIZE   1
 

Functions

char * if_indextoname (unsigned int ifindex, char *ifname)
 
void if_freenameindex (struct if_nameindex *ptr)
 
struct if_nameindex * if_nameindex (void)
 
unsigned int if_nametoindex (const char *ifname)
 

Macro Definition Documentation

◆ IF_NAMESIZE

#define IF_NAMESIZE   1

Function Documentation

◆ if_freenameindex()

void if_freenameindex ( struct if_nameindex * ptr)

◆ if_indextoname()

char * if_indextoname ( unsigned int ifindex,
char * ifname )

◆ if_nameindex()

struct if_nameindex * if_nameindex ( void )

◆ if_nametoindex()

unsigned int if_nametoindex ( const char * ifname)